免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

c2c电商平台小程序开发案例

C2C(Consumer-to-Consumer)电商平台,是指个人与个人之间的交易,或称为“个体经济”。随着移动互联网技术的发展,C2C电商平台以小程序形式逐渐出现,成为市场中的一个新兴力量。本文将介绍C2C电商平台小程序开发的原理和案例。

一、C2C电商平台小程序的原理

C2C电商平台小程序是在微信公众号的基础上开发的,它利用微信小程序的特性来快速打造功能完善、易用、快捷的电商平台。小程序内置了微信支付功能,让用户在浏览商品、下订单、支付等一系列购买流程中立即完成。

C2C电商平台小程序的开发过程主要有以下几个步骤:

1. 产品规划

在产品规划中,需要定义产品的功能、界面、用户体验等方面。同时,需要根据目标用户的需求定义产品的策略、细节及相关技术问题。

2. 需求分析和评审

在需求分析和评审中,需要对产品的需求明确,并确定最终用户期望达到的效果。同时,还需要评审产品的结构、功能、技术特点以及其他相关方面,以确保产品符合用户和开发者预期。

3. 界面设计

界面设计是产品开发的一个重要环节。设计师需要将产品需求转化为具体的UI设计,包括整体风格、设计趋势等方面。同时,还需要考虑用户体验,提高产品的易用性。

4. 技术选型

在技术选型中,需要根据需求分析确定后端语言、前端框架等,并制定相应的技术方案,确定最终实现方式和技术特点。

5. 后端开发

后端开发是指在技术选型的基础上完成后端代码编写。主要包括数据库设计、API开发、消息推送等方面。同时,需要配合前端开发人员,提供相应的技术支持。

6. 前端开发

前端开发主要负责小程序的视觉表现,包括界面设计、交互、页面布局等方面。前端工程师需要根据需求、UI设计图和产品规划图,实现小程序的交互效果和用户体验。

7. 测试上线

在测试上线阶段,需要对整个流程进行测试和调试。同时,开发者还需要在微信小程序平台上申请小程序,并上线运营。

二、C2C电商平台小程序开发案例

以下为一个C2C电商平台小程序开发案例:

1. 产品规划

该C2C电商平台小程序主要面向淘宝和闲鱼购物爱好者,旨在提供便捷的在线购物方式。主要功能包括浏览商品、发布商品、搜索商品、下订单、在线支付、用户评价等。同时,平台还支持买卖双方在平台内进行即时通讯。

2. 需求分析和评审

该C2C电商平台小程序需要提供便捷、快速的购买方式,并支持多种在线支付方式。同时,还需要提供用户评价、图片展示等功能,以增强用户的购物体验。

3. 界面设计

该C2C电商平台小程序采用简洁、清新的设计风格,主色调为蓝色和灰色。同时,每个页面都采用了清晰的图标和文字描述,提高了用户体验。

4. 技术选型

该C2C电商平台小程序采用了前端框架Vue.js和后端语言PHP进行开发。并采用了微信支付SDK、即时通讯SDK等技术,以保证使用体验和跨平台的兼容性。

5. 后端开发

在后端开发中,主要实现了用户注册、账户系统、商品分类管理、商品发布系统、订单管理和支付系统等功能,并采用了LARAVEL框架进行开发。

6. 前端开发

在前端开发中,主要实现了商品浏览、搜索、下单、在线支付和用户评价等功能,并采用微信小程序框架进行开发。

7. 测试上线

在测试上线阶段,主要进行了Bug修复和性能优化,并在微信小程序平台上进行了发布和推广。

经过以上几个步骤的开发,该C2C电商平台小程序最终实现了商品的展示和购买、支付、用户评价等功能。立足用户需求,优化用户体验,成为了一款备受欢迎的C2C电商平台小程序。


相关知识:
安徽建材行业小程序开发定制
随着移动互联网的发展,小程序成为一种重要的互联网应用形式,小程序极大地满足了用户在各个场景中对于快捷、精准、个性化服务的需求。近年来,安徽建材行业也开始逐渐向小程序平台转型,通过小程序带动线上销售,提高用户体验,增加品牌影响力,进一步推动了安徽建材行业的发
2023-08-09
安徽平台化小程序开发公司
安徽平台化小程序开发公司是一种专门致力于小程序开发的公司,其目的是为了帮助用户更便捷地使用小程序。下面将介绍安徽平台化小程序开发公司的原理以及其详细情况。一、原理安徽平台化小程序开发公司的原理主要有以下三种:1.提供一站式服务小程序的开发过程十分复杂,有设
2023-08-09
安徽代驾小程序开发定制
随着互联网的发展,代驾行业也逐渐进入了移动互联网时代。安徽代驾小程序的开发定制就是顺应这一趋势而诞生的一款移动互联网应用。代驾小程序是指具有代驾功能的微型应用程序,用户可以通过代驾小程序完成在线约车、支付、评价等全过程。安徽代驾小程序的开发定制原理主要包括
2023-08-09
安卓开发设计小程序
安卓开发设计小程序是指使用安卓开发框架实现小程序应用的过程。小程序是移动互联网上的一种轻量级应用,相比于传统的app,小程序不需要下载安装即可使用,用户可以直接通过各大平台上的小程序入口进入使用。从技术角度来看,小程序基于web开发技术,通过轻量级前端框架
2023-08-09
taro开发小程序怎么样
Taro是一种基于React的多端开发解决方案,旨在实现使用一套代码可以编写出在多个平台下运行的应用,如小程序、H5、React Native、Web等。随着小程序的普及和不断更新,Taro成为了越来越多企业和个人的选择。下面将详细介绍Taro在小程序开发
2023-08-09
php 小程序新订单通知开发
在一个小程序中,当用户下单成功后,我们需要向商家发送一个新订单的消息通知。PHP作为一种服务器端编程语言,可以帮助我们实现这个功能。本文将介绍如何使用PHP开发小程序的新订单通知功能。说明,本文将以微信小程序举例,因此需要提前了解微信小程序开发相关知识。1
2023-08-09
h5开发和小程序开发
HTML5开发和小程序开发是近年来非常流行的两种开发方式,它们的出现意味着Web开发和手机应用开发的进一步发展,我们将在下面进行详细的介绍和比较。一、H5开发1. H5是什么?HTML5是HTML语言的第五个版本,它是一种用于展示和交互式媒体的标准技术。H
2023-08-09
小程序第三方开发工具怎么用
小程序第三方开发工具是一种供开发者使用的工具,用于创建、调试和预览小程序。它通常包括了编辑器、调试器、预览器和上传器等多个部分,能让开发者更方便地进行小程序开发和维护工作。下面我就来详细介绍一下小程序第三方开发工具的使用原理和具体操作步骤。一、小程序第三方
2023-05-26
小程序开发工具中的那些快捷键
小程序开发工具是开发小程序的集成开发环境(IDE),它集成了代码编辑、调试、构建和发布等功能模块,提供了一个高效便捷的开发环境。而在开发小程序时,掌握一些快捷键可以使得开发效率更高,省去大量鼠标操作。下面介绍一些常用的小程序开发工具快捷键。1. Ctrl
2023-05-26
微信小程序开发工具的一些坑
微信小程序开发工具是一款跨平台的开发工具,旨在帮助开发者快速地开发和调试微信小程序。这款工具包含了多个模块,如代码编辑器、资源管理器、调试器等等,其中也有一些需要注意的坑点。一、开发工具版本微信小程序开发工具有两种版本,分别是稳定版和测试版。虽然测试版会提
2023-05-26
联客易微信小程序开发工具
联客易微信小程序开发工具是一款专业的微信小程序开发平台,可以帮助开发者快速开发小程序并实现一系列的功能。本文将从原理和详细介绍两个方面来进行阐述。一、原理联客易微信小程序开发工具采用了类似于HBuilder的web开发模式,采用了前端框架Vue.js,并且
2023-05-26
qq小程序开发工具如何下载
QQ小程序是一种基于QQ平台的第三方应用程序。由于QQ的用户量极为庞大,因此QQ小程序成为了一个非常受欢迎的新兴应用类型。如果您想开发自己的QQ小程序,首先需要下载QQ小程序开发工具。下面是关于QQ小程序开发工具下载的详细介绍。QQ小程序开发工具的下载QQ
2023-05-22